Worthy Spicy Tuna Crispy Rice Ingredients
For the Rice
- Sushi Rice – Provides a sweet flavor and ideal texture for sushi; substitute with short-grain rice in a pinch.
- Rice Vinegar – Adds a tangy kick to the rice; apple cider vinegar can be a great substitute.
- Granulated Sugar – Balances the tanginess of the vinegar; no substitute necessary.
- Kosher Salt – Enhances flavor; feel free to use sea salt instead.
- Grapeseed Oil – Perfect for frying, yielding that crispy exterior; can be traded for canola or vegetable oil.
For the Topping
- Sushi-Grade Ahi Tuna – The star ingredient providing fresh flavor and a tender bite; bigeye or yellowfin are excellent alternatives.
- Scallions – Introduce a mild onion flavor to the mix; if unavailable, chives can work as a substitute.
- Jalapeño – Infuses heat and brightness; omit for less spice or swap with a milder chili.
- Black Sesame Seeds – Adds a nutty flavor and an appealing touch; white sesame seeds can be used instead.
For the Spicy Mayo
- Kewpie Mayonnaise – Delivers creaminess, essential for that spicy kick; regular mayo with a touch of vinegar is a good swap.
- Sriracha – The secret ingredient for a spicy kick; adjust to your heat preference.
- Ponzu Sauce – Enhances the umami flavor; soy sauce can serve as a suitable alternative.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Worthy Spicy Tuna Crispy Rice
Step 1: Prepare Sushi Rice
Rinse 1 cup of sushi rice under cold water until the water runs clear, then cook according to package instructions. While the rice is cooking, combine ¼ cup rice vinegar, 2 tablespoons granulated sugar, and 1 teaspoon kosher salt in a saucepan over low heat until dissolved. Once the rice is cooked, gently mix the vinegar mixture with the warm rice, ensuring each grain is coated, and set aside to cool.
Step 2: Shape and Cool Rice
Once the seasoned rice has cooled down, line a rectangular dish with plastic wrap and firmly press the rice into a ½-inch thick layer. Cover the top with another piece of plastic wrap and refrigerate the rice for at least 3 hours or overnight, allowing it to firm up for easier slicing. This step is crucial for achieving the perfect texture in your Worthy Spicy Tuna Crispy Rice.
Step 3: Prepare Tuna Mixture
While the rice cools, finely chop 6 ounces of sushi-grade ahi tuna and place it in a bowl. Add 2 sliced scallions, and then in a separate bowl, mix together 2 tablespoons of Kewpie mayonnaise, 1 tablespoon of sriracha, and 1 teaspoon of ponzu sauce; adjust the sriracha to your heat preference. Combine the tuna with the spicy mayo mixture, refrigerate the blend, and let the flavors meld together.
Step 4: Fry Crispy Rice
After chilling, remove the rice from the fridge. Cut it into rectangles or squares using a sharp knife. Heat ¼ cup of grapeseed o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Fry the rice pieces in batches for about 2 minutes per side or until they’re golden brown and crispy. Use a slotted spatula to transfer the crispy rice to a plate lined with paper towels to drain excess oil.
Step 5: Assemble and Serve
To assemble your Worthy Spicy Tuna Crispy Rice, place a generous scoop of the spicy tuna mixture on top of each crispy rice piece. Sprinkle with black sesame seeds and add thin slices of jalapeño for an extra kick. Serve immediately for that irresistible contrast of crunchy rice and tender tuna, delighting your guests with this visually stunning and delicious appetizer.

How to Store and Freeze Worthy Spicy Tuna Crispy Rice
Fridge: Store any leftover spicy tuna mixture in an airtight container for up to 2 days. Avoid combining tuna with crispy rice until ready to serve to maintain texture.
Freezer: The seasoned rice can be frozen for up to 1 month. Cut it into pieces before freezing to make frying easier later. Wrap in plastic wrap and place in a freezer-safe bag.
Reheating: For best results, reheat the crispy rice in a hot skillet for a few minutes until warmed through. Avoid microwaving, as it may make the rice chewy rather than crisp.

Make Ahead Options
Prepare your Worthy Spicy Tuna Crispy Rice in advance for a fuss-free entertaining experience! You can make the sushi rice up to 24 hours ahead by cooking, seasoning, and pressing it into a container—just remember to refrigerate it covered. The tuna mixture can also be prepared up to 3 days in advance; simply mix the diced tuna with scallions and spicy mayo, then store it in an airtight container in the fridge. To finish, heat the oil and fry the rice only when you’re ready to serve for that irresistible crunch. Expert Tips for Worthy Spicy Tuna Crispy Rice
• Fresh Ingredients: Always use sushi-grade tuna for this dish. It guarantees the best taste and safety, ensuring a delightful experience in every bite.
• Perfect Rice Cooking: Achieve ideal sushi rice texture by rinsing thoroughly before cooking. Unrinsed rice can lead to gummy results, impacting the overall dish.
• Cooling Time: Don’t rush the refrigeration step! Cooling the rice for at least three hours ensures it firms up, making it easier to cut into perfect shapes for frying.
• Oil Temperature: Make sure your oil is hot enough before frying. If it’s too cool, the rice won’t crisp properly, leading to soggy bites that won’t impress your guests.

What can I do if my crispy rice isn’t crisping up properly?
Very common! Ensure your oil is hot enough (around 350°F) before frying—if the oil isn’t hot, the rice won’t crisp up. Fry in small batches for better results, usually about 2 minutes per side is ideal. Also, avoid overcrowding the pan, as it can lower the oil temperature.
